I only find this an issue on one of my pcs. I have countered it by setting one WU-rich application, SETI, to "No new tasks" until WUs run down to a point when I need to top up the stock. By that time the pc has usually called down some LHC units.

A simple measure like this should suffice whilst work goes on behind the scenes to address emerging issues and create more WUs. I am certain the team is more than aware of the present situation and the frustration some enthusiasts feel.
